apk伪加密技术

首先了解下什么样的apk,是经过经过伪加密的
[img]http://dl2.iteye.com/upload/attachment/0104/4733/645c816f-4211-351a-b42c-5c489d0d98a9.png[/img]
我们经过压缩软件打开需要密码的就是伪加密的apk
其实这种加密的效果不大
下面分析下吧,
首先新建一个zip压缩文件,修改后缀名为apk
然后是使用工具加密
[img]http://dl2.iteye.com/upload/attachment/0104/4735/6684d3c6-c91c-38a1-9fcb-9a9cfcb90329.png[/img]
[img]http://dl2.iteye.com/upload/attachment/0104/4737/0111a3fa-9771-3055-b7cb-13b67cd09eda.png[/img]
应压缩软件打开下
[img]http://dl2.iteye.com/upload/attachment/0104/4739/bd2daa81-aa2e-3a27-a5b7-afc55f9a77e3.png[/img]
用uc 对比下
快速二进制比较
[img]http://dl2.iteye.com/upload/attachment/0104/4741/be1a4b67-bb40-30f5-9b7c-1480c536ce05.png[/img]
下面是加密的
[img]http://dl2.iteye.com/upload/attachment/0104/4743/e9ce653b-4726-307a-951b-39cd0e9f3354.png[/img]
经过比较可知 所谓的伪加密就是说 在 压缩文件中,压缩文件名后的PK 01 02 后的第五个字节改为01
即可,解密就是对应的改为00
下面是加密后的解密
[img]http://dl2.iteye.com/upload/attachment/0104/4745/0ee01659-540d-3e7b-806b-1a97b1dd5258.png[/img]
pk 01 02 后的第5个字节改为00
[img]http://dl2.iteye.com/upload/attachment/0104/4749/1f8bbbae-b202-3995-9eac-2be79ff02dde.png[/img]
再打开看看
[img]http://dl2.iteye.com/upload/attachment/0104/4751/122ae4ce-817f-3b4f-a0b2-0b4584fb24b4.png[/img]
好了 这就是所谓的apk伪加密,我看了 那个爱加密的教程,只是说了个大概,
所以就在分享下
  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值